Assessment and Inspection
We start with a quick but thorough inspection of your property. We check for standing water, damp areas, and signs of damage. We use tools like moisture meters and thermal imaging to find hidden issues. This step helps us plan the best course of action. It’s not just about removing water. It’s about knowing where the problem is.
Water Extraction
We use powerful pumps and wet vacuums to get rid of standing water. This step can take anywhere from 1 to 3 hours depending on the size of the area. We work quickly to prevent mold and structural damage. Our equipment is built for the job. It’s not just about speed. It’s about getting the job done right.
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water is out, we move on to drying. We use industrial-grade dehumidifiers and air movers to speed up the process. This step can take 2 to 5 days. We monitor the progress every day to make sure everything is drying properly. Our goal is to get your home back to normal as fast as possible.
Disinfection and Sanitization
We don’t leave anything to chance. We clean and disinfect all affected areas to stop the spread of mold and bacteria. This step is critical, especially in areas where water has been standing for more than 48 hours. We use safe, effective products that are approved for use in homes. Clogged Drain Water Removal v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small puddle in a bathroom | Yes | No | It’s manageable with a wet vacuum but can lead to mold if not dried properly. |
| Water backing up into a basement | No | Yes | It’s a serious issue that needs professional equipment and expertise. |
| Slow-draining sink with a clog | Yes | No | It’s possible to clear it with a plunger or drain snake, but it’s not a long-term solution. |
| Water under a floor | No | Yes | It’s hidden and can cause serious damage if not treated quickly. |
| Standing water in a garage | No | Yes | It’s a health hazard and can damage your property if left unattended. |
| Water from a broken pipe | No | Yes | It’s a serious issue that needs immediate attention to prevent more damage. |

|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Amount of water, size of area, and location of the problem. |
| Dehumidification | $300 – $1,500 | How long the drying process takes and the size of the space. |
| Disinfection | $200 – $1,000 | Amount of affected area and the level of contamination. |
| Structural Drying | $400 – $2,000 | How much of your home is affected and the materials involved. |
| Inspection and Assessment | $100 – $500 | Complexity of the job and how many areas need checking. |
| Final Cleanup | $200 – $1,200 | How much work is needed to restore your space to normal. |
